Ministry Of Transport And Civil Aviation Proactive Road Safety Drivers Rehab Programme Set For Tobago On September 30th And October 1st, 2025
September 23, 2025- The government’s free Driver’s Rehabilitation Programme is set to take place in Tobago on Tuesday, September 30th, and Wednesday, October 1st, at the Milshirv Administrative Complex, following earlier sessions in Caroni.
Mandated by the 2017 Motor Vehicles and Road Traffic (Amendment) Act, the initiative offers more than 700 previously disqualified drivers—under the now-defunct Demerit Points System—the opportunity to regain their licenses at no cost.
The programme comes amid concerning road safety statistics, including a sharp rise in fatalities early in 2025 and a 400% increase in deaths among motorcyclists. Over two days, participants will cover key topics designed to transform high-risk behaviour, promote responsible driving, and help curb the trend of road-related deaths.
